Narratio is a stage-driven Go orchestrator for turning D&D session audio into polished transcripts and generated artifacts.
|
Narratio is a stage-driven Go orchestrator for turning D&D session audio into polished transcripts and generated artifacts.
|
||||||
|
|
||||||
It runs a deterministic workflow across `prepare`, `transcribe`, `merge`, `polish`, `normalize`, `trim`, `analyze`, and `publish`, with manifest-driven resume and restore support.
